SNP Filtering

  • Wrote 'extractSNPlines.pl' to get pileup lines by line number (instead of grep-ing for position)
./extractSNPlines.pl notwo.pileup snoOrigLocs.txt > snp.pileup
  • Discovered that pileup does not output SNP calls. Modify 'heterozygousSNPfilter.pl' to extract heterozygous SNPs 'cns.final.snp', put call into hash keyed by position. Then iterate through lines of snp.pileup and count occurrences of each called nucleotide.

Calculating False Positives

  • dbSNP is a possibly biased database, while the 1000genome SNPs are unbiased (based on sequencing data, not just looking at known SNP locations).
  • 1000genome SNP list may be smaller than list of true SNPs.
  • If there are no false positives, then the proportion of our SNPs in common with dbSNPs should be independent of presence in dbSNP.

Yesterday's SNP Frequency Measurements

  • Possible over-representation of heterozygous SNPs: much more common among presumed false positives than direct hits.
' In dbSNP Not in dbSNP
Homozygous: 55.33% 20.72%
Heterozygous: 44.67% 79.28%
Transition: 76.48% 67.17%
Transversion: 23.52% 32.83%
Total: 7377 999
